Existential Meaning Through Illness
Journal of Psychosocial Oncology, 2004Abstract This study probed the effects of both level of existential meaning and coping processes on quality of life for patients with breast cancer. Results of bivariate correlation analyses with a sample of 248 women one to five years after diagnosis showed that a high level of meaning was strongly correlated with a high quality of life (r= .448, p

Existential Meaning and Terror Management
2019Terror management theory (TMT) posits that the uniquely human awareness of death engenders potentially debilitating existential terror that is “managed” by subscribing to cultural worldviews providing a sense that life has meaning as well as opportunities to obtain self-esteem, in pursuit of psychological equanimity in the present and literal or ...
